Fortis Institute-Wayne

Fortis Institute-Wayne is a Private, Less than 2 years school located in Wayne, NJ. The 2023 average tuition & fees is $16,264 over its programs in average.
The school has a total enrollment of 365 and it offers 7 programs.

Largest Vocational Programs

The largest vocational programs at Fortis Institute-Wayne is Medical/Clinical Assistant. Its 2023 tuition and fees are $16,264 and the national average is $16,239.
Its tuition is similar than national average of Medical/Clinical Assistant program. The length of the program is 780 contact hours ( or credit hours) and the average time to complete is 9 months.

2023 Tuition & Fees, Living Costs

The average undergraduate tuition & fees at Fortis Institute-Wayne is $16,264 for academic year 2022-2023. The amount is the average costs over all career programs and costs for some program may quietly differ from the average cost.
Fortis Institute-Wayne offers the alternative tuition plans .
84% of enrolled students have received grants and/or scholarships and the average amount of received financial aid is $4,601 (exclude student loans).

Admission, Enrollment, and Graduation

Total 365 students are attending at Fortis Institute-Wayne. There are 22 full-time faculty (instructional/teaching staffs) and 12 part-time faculty teaching for the school.
The students to faculty ratio is 15 to 1 (6.67%). The number of non-teaching staffs is 40 (full-time) and 15 (part-time).
